2. Key Ingredients for the Perfect Deer and Elk Burger Recipe
To create the best deer burger recipes, you need the right ingredients. Here’s what you’ll need to get started:
- 1 pound ground deer meat
- 1 pound ground elk meat
- 1/2 cup breadcrumbs: These help bind the burger together and add moisture. For a twist, consider using panko breadcrumbs for extra crispiness.
- 1/4 cup diced onion: Adds a subtle sweetness and savory depth. Red or yellow onions work well.
- 2 cloves garlic, minced: Essential for that aromatic punch. Freshly minced garlic is always best!
- 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ce: This ingredient enhances the umami flavor, making your burgers incredibly savory.
- 1 teaspoon salt: Balances the flavors and seasons the meat.
- 1 teaspoon black pepper: Adds a bit of spice and enhances the overall taste.
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ika: For a subtle smoky flavor that complements the game meat perfectly.
- Cheese slices (optional): Cheddar, Swiss, or provolone are great choices.
- Burger buns: Choose your favorite type. Brioche buns are a popular choice for their rich flavor and soft texture.

3. Step 1: Season the Meat – Preparing the Base for the Best Deer Burger Recipes
Start by combining the ground deer meat and ground elk meat in a large mixing bowl. This blend is the foundation of our delicious elk burger recipe. Add breadcrumbs, diced onion, minced garlic, Worcestershire sauce, salt, black pepper, and smoked paprika. Mix well until all ingredients are evenly incorporated. Be gentle, as overmixing can result in tough burgers. This step ensures every bite is packed with flavor!
4. Step 2: Shape the Patties for Your Gourmet Elk Burger Recipe
Once your meat mixture is ready, use your hands to shape it into equal-sized burger patties. Aim for about 1-inch thick to ensure they cook evenly: thinner patties will cook faster, while thicker ones may remain pink in the middle. Consider making a slight indentation in the center of each patty to prevent them from puffing up during cooking. Place the formed patties on a plate, and let them rest for about 10 minutes to boost their juiciness during cooking. 5. Step 3: Grill the Burgers to Perfection – Cooking Your Dream Deer and Elk Burger
Preheat your grill to medium-high heat. A hot grill is essential for achieving a good sear and preventing the burgers from sticking. Once ready, place the deer and elk burger patties on the grill. Cook for about 6-7 minutes on one side, then flip and cook for another 5-6 minutes, or until they reach an internal temperature of 160°F. Using a meat thermometer is crucial for ensuring your burgers are safely cooked. If adding cheese, place a slice on each patty in the last minute of cooking, allowing it to melt beautifully over the juicy meat. The key to a perfect elk burger recipe is patience and precision!

7. Storage Tips for Your Deer and Elk Burgers
If you have leftover deer or elk burger patties, allow them to cool completely before storing in an airtight container. They can be kept in the refrigerator for up to 3 days or frozen for up to 3 months. To reheat, grill or pan-fry for best results. Deer,Elk Burger Recipes
Discover the rich and unique flavors of our Deer and Elk Burger Recipes, perfect for any outdoor gathering or family meal. These juicy, flavor-packed delights are sure to impress your guests!
- Total Time: 30 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
Ingredients
- 1 pound ground deer meat
- 1 pound ground elk meat
- 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
- 1/4 cup diced onion
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1 teaspoon black pepper
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
- Cheese slices (optional)
- Burger buns
- Toppings: lettuce, tomato, pickles, and your choice of condiments
Instructions
- Combine ground deer and elk meat in a large bowl and add breadcrumbs, onion, garlic, Worcestershire sauce, salt, pepper, and paprika. Mix well.
- Shape the mixture into equal-sized, 1-inch thick patties and let them rest for 10 minutes.
- Preheat your grill to medium-high heat. Cook the patties for 6-7 minutes on one side, then flip and cook for another 5-6 minutes until they reach an internal temperature of 160°F.
- Transfer cooked patties to toasted burger buns and top with lettuce, tomato, pickles, and condiments of your choice.
Notes
- Leftover patties can be stored in an airtight container for up to 3 days in the refrigerator or 3 months in the freezer.
- For best reheating results, grill or pan-fry the patties.
